The proper dryer wire size depends on the ampacity, and when the current draw is 30 amps, the wire should be 10 gauge. learn how to choose the right wire size and breaker for your electric dryer based on its voltage needs. according to the national electric code, a dedicated circuit for an electric dryer should be 30 amps at minimum. 40 amp loads are common for dryers with a higher load and higher power requirements. assuming you have an electrical dryer, typical power use might be anywhere from 1800 w to 5000 w source.
